What Is Designing 3D and How Does It Work in Fashion?

Designing 3D involves using specialized software to develop digital 3D models of garments. Designers input patterns and sketches into the software, which renders the fabric’s texture, fit, and movement virtually. How Does Designing 3D Improve the Fashion Design Process?

3D design accelerates the workflow by allowing immediate visualization and adjustment of garments without physical samples. It reduces errors, saves time, and cuts costs related to traditional prototyping. Designers can instantly preview different materials and designs in a virtual environment, enhancing creativity and decision-making.

Why Is Designing 3D Important for Sustainable Fashion?

Designing 3D reduces waste by minimizing the need for physical samples, which typically consume fabrics and energy. The virtual try-on and prototyping process lowers production errors and excess inventory, directly supporting sustainability goals. Does Designing 3D Reduce Production Costs?

Yes, by eliminating many physical samples and allowing early detection of fitting or design issues, designing 3D drastically lowers material waste, labor, and shipping expenses, achieving significant cost savings and faster cycles.

Has Designing 3D Changed Fashion Retail?

Designing 3D enables virtual try-ons and digital showrooms, providing interactive customer experiences. Retailers can showcase collections digitally, reducing reliance on physical inventory while increasing engagement and sales conversions.
